In an equilibrium what is true?
Question 4 options:
The constant for the forward reaction is the inverse of the constant for the reverse reqction
There is no increase in the concentration of either the products or reactants
All answers are true
The rate of the forward reaction equals the rate of the reverse

Explanation / Answer
At equilibrium, both forward and backward reaction takes place but rate of forward and backward reaction is equal. Due to this there is no net change in concentration of reactant and product
So, option 2 and 4 are true
The ratio of concentration of products to reactant is equals to a constant and this constant is known as equilibrium constant
The constant for the forward reaction is Kc and the inverse is 1/Kc.
So, option 1 is true
Answer: All answers are true
